Nonlinear magnetic response of the magnetized vacuum to applied electric field

Abstract

We find first nonlinear correction to the field, produced by a static charge at rest in a background constant magnetic field. It is quadratic in the charge and purely magnetic. The third-rank polarization tensor - the nonlinear response function - is written within the local approximation of the effective action in an otherwise model- and approximation-independent way within any P-invariant nonlinear electrodynamics, QED included.
